The First Man is based on an unfinished autobiographic novel by French author Albert Camus (The Stranger). The film follows his alter-ego Jean Cornery (Jacques Gamblin – The Names of Love), a famous writer who returns to Algiers on the eve of the Algerian war. As he wanders through the streets of the city, he not only remembers his childhood but is also confronted to the reality of a colonial world on the verge of collapse.
With the attachment to his mother symbolizing the strong link he has to this city and country, the film successfully intertwines family and political narratives, impartially showing a world in mutation from both French and the Algerian perspectives. The film paints a poignant, yet tragic, picture of the tumultuous racial relations between the French and Arabs in Algeria during the mid-'50s.
